从列名列表中动态创建结构列可以通过以下步骤实现:
以下是一个示例代码(使用Python语言):
# 列名列表
column_names = ['name', 'age', 'gender']
# 创建空的数据结构
data_structure = {}
# 遍历列名列表
for column_name in column_names:
# 创建新的结构列
column = {}
# 设置结构列的名称
column['name'] = column_name
# 可根据需要设置其他属性,例如数据类型、长度、约束等
# 将结构列添加到数据结构中
data_structure[column_name] = column
# 输出动态创建的结构列
print(data_structure)
在这个示例中,我们使用一个字典来表示数据结构,每个结构列都是一个字典项,其中键是列名,值是一个包含列属性的字典。你可以根据需要选择适合的数据结构来存储动态创建的结构列。
对于腾讯云相关产品,可以使用腾讯云的云数据库MySQL、云数据库CynosDB等产品来存储和管理动态创建的结构列。你可以参考腾讯云的官方文档来了解更多关于这些产品的信息和使用方法。
领取专属 10元无门槛券
手把手带您无忧上云